Tweak your franchise experience

Hello guys, I've been around quite a while here at OS. I've learned a lot from reading the posts and trying different slider sets. I have to say thanks a lot to you guys for your hard work.

Today I want to share my personal adjustments to imitate the often-quoted sim-style kind of play in franchise.

For contract negotiations I use the following chart:

> 33 years: 5% Bonus Rating:
32-33 years: 7% Bonus 80-84: 5% Bonus
30-31 years: 10% Bonus 85-89: 10% Bonus
27-29 years: 15% Bonus 90-95: 15% Bonus
< 27 years: 20% Bonus >95: 20% Bonus

To determine the length of the contract I take this chart:

Rating:
< 60: 1 year deal
61-65: 2 year deal
66-75: 3 year deal
76-85: 4 year deal
86-90: 5 year deal
> 90: 6 year deal

As an example if you have an 28 year old player with a rating (please read further for this) of 87 I go in the negotiation screen and take a 25% Bonus (15% + 10%) of the base salary and a length of 5 years. If you adjust the base salary you have to adjust the Bonus as well. The diffficult is not only to match the asked money but to hand a length of the contract the player is willing to take.

These "rules" prevent me from signing players to long term deals with no bonus payments. This leads to difficult decisions every year.

Another important point for me is the use of my own OVR rating formulas. The OVR is one of the most discussed and overrated aspect of the game. I ask myself which attributes are important to the specific postion. I use the attached xlsx-file at the beginning of every season and fill in the data to get my personal rating which can vary from the madden calculated OVR.

You have to consider that some postions (FB) will have lower ratings compared to other positions (WR). But when you use this formulas you will get a feeling for every position. The percentual seperation is -of course- adjustable.

Another additional statistic element I use is to evaluate the production of every player and the run/pass ration of my own and of the opposing team. Again I fill in the data after every game to have a better feeling for the production of my team.

Perhaps I'm able to improve the franchise experience of some people or to to give somebody something to think about.

Hey preaceps,

you can adjust the base salary to your liking, as high as you want. But when you adjust the base salary you have to adjust the Bonus as well. This prevents you from getting cheap contracts. The predetermined length of the contract involves the risk that the player reject your offer. But sometimes star player just try the free agency if the don't get what they want.

The formulas are hidden in the first lines. You can adjust them to whatever you want. These are based off my own ideas.

Following OPs formula and trying to keep Dareus with the same avg total salary, you should have done 30% of the 44 mil. It would end up being 2.64 bonus each year for 5 years (13.2m bonus total). Then if he doesn't accept and you want to increase his total salary, bump up his bonus to keep it at 30% of the new total offer.
